Can you believe it? Raw Meat is five years old!

It all started in the summer of 2010, when Snow Crash asked if anyone was interested in pooling together to rent some space to learn to roller skate together. The first lesson consisted of Snow, saying, “Um, well, if I blow a whistle, maybe we could all stop at the same time?”

In the years since then, so many fabulous people have come to Raw Meat to learn to skate. On July 18, you are all invited to come back, and celebrate five years of roller skating. Join us from 10 am to noon at Royal City Curling Club.

New to skating? You are invited too! Raw Meat wouldn’t exist without a constant stream of new skaters.

We’ll skate, we’ll laugh, we’ll play some games, we’ll reminisce. Mostly, we’ll be ridiculous, and have a blast.
